An 18-0 spurt to bridge the first and second quarters in Monday’s third-round playoff game gave the Boerne girls all the momentum they needed against a solid Navasota team.
Boerne held a 38-8 lead at halftime in Georgetown before closing it out by doubling up the Lady Rattlers with a final score of 50-25. Navasota ends its year at 30-4.
The Lady Greyhounds (31-4) advance to the fourth round or regional semifinals this Friday in Kingsville where they’ll face the winner of the Devine – West Oso contest scheduled for Tuesday.
